WebFollow these steps in spring to fix a cordyline that has become leggy: Cut its top off, leaving 10–20cm of clear trunk below the last leaves. Stick this head directly into the soil or into a pot. Cut it near the ground, leaving a stump that's at least 10cm tall. You'll now be left with the middle piece of trunk. WebJan 3, 2024 · Why Hard Pruning? WebSep 21, 2024 · Prune the entire plant back to control its overall size. Cut as much excess from the Ti as you wish, down to 12 inches above the soil line. New shoots will soon emerge from below the cuts. Prune any stem from the Ti plant to encourage multiple new shoots to fill a sparse area in its place. WebCordyline indivisa. mountain cabbage tree. A slow-growing, evergreen erect tree reaching heights of 3m or more. The lance-shaped, blue-green leaves are relatively broad at 10-30cm wide and from 0.6-2m long with an orange-brown midrib. Small, white, star-shaped flowers borne in dense clusters in summer are followed by tiny purple-blue fruits
